Samuel Richmond[1]

  • M, b. 23 September 1668, d. between 11 June 1736 and 20 July 1736

Samuel Richmond was born on 23 September 1668 at Taunton. He was the son of John Richmond and Abigail Rogers.

Samuel Richmond married Mehitable Andrews, daughter of Henry Andrews and Mary Wadsworth, on 20 December 1694 at Taunton.

Samuel Richmond married Elizabeth King, daughter of Philip King and Judith Whitman, after 17 June 1708.

Samuel Richmond died between 11 June 1736 and 20 July 1736 at Taunton.

Children of Samuel Richmond and Mehitable Andrews

  • 1. Samuel Richmond+ b. 16 Oct 1695, d. b 1 Aug 1767
  • 2. Oliver Richmond+ b. 25 Aug 1697, d. a 26 Oct 1763
  • 3. Thomas Richmond b. 10 Sep 1700, d. a 13 Sep 1737
  • 4. Hannah Richmond+ b. 29 Aug 1702
  • 5. Lydia Richmond+ b. 14 May 1704

Children of Samuel Richmond and Elizabeth King

  • 1. Silas Richmond+ b. c 1710, d. 21 Feb 1784
  • 2. Mehitable Richmond+ b. c 1712
